Whether boundary walls are included in plot area ?

(Querist) 19 December 2013 This query is : Resolved 
I have a tenant in left portion of my shop having 4' x 18' carpet area (excluding boundary walls).

Later I agreed to sell 4' x 18' portion (in which he is already in possession) to him.

Now he is saying that he will purchase only the 4' x 18' area inside the walls.

This means that he will get area of 5'' x 18' (under left wall) for free.


What is your opinion ?
Whether the left wall shall be included in his Area ?

Guest (Expert) 19 December 2013
Ask him a simple question, if you remove your boundary walls, what he would do to separate the portion bought by him?

The purchaser may be asked to build his own boundary wall within the area of 4' x 18' as boundary walls are owned individually in whose are that exist. You can include that clause in the sale deed.
